Rock Band Recital Fail (Viral Performance)
During a Grosse Pointe Music Academy spring recital, a student band known as “Rubber Band” took the stage expecting a normal performance. What followed quickly turned into a viral moment that has been viewed by millions.
Watch the 60-second video below:
The group was performing Weezer’s “Undone – The Sweater Song” when things took an unexpected turn. Despite the chaos, the moment became a memorable and widely shared performance.

What This Shows About Performing Live
- Live performance requires preparation and coordination
- Unexpected situations can happen at any time
- Confidence comes from experience and repetition
- Learning to recover is part of becoming a musician
Moments like this are part of the learning process and often become the most memorable experiences for students.
